Abstract

The invention discloses an electrolytic sterilization device and a control method thereof. The electrolytic sterilization device comprises an electrolytic cell, equipment for spraying electrolyte after electrolysis in the electrolytic cell outwards, a water sprayer and a power mechanism, wherein the electrolytic cell is used for electrolyzing liquid to generate a strong oxidant; the water sprayer is used for carrying out sterilization on external equipment; the power mechanism is connected between the electrolytic cell and the water sprayer and is used for conveying the electrolyte after the electrolysis in the electrolytic cell to the water sprayer; the electrolytic cell comprises a water tank and electrodes arranged in the water tank, the base material of the electrodes can be titanium, and a coating on the surface of the base material can be platinum metals. Low voltage electrolysis is carried out only on the solution such as ordinary tap water, and the killing effect of the electrolyte for microorganisms such as bacteria and mycetes can reach more than 99.9%; moreover, the whole process is safe and reliable, poisonous and harmful chemical substances do not need to be used, and the electrolytic sterilization device can realize the comprehensive performances integrated with cleanness, sterilization and humidification for the equipment such as air conditioning evaporators, filter screens or purification machines, so that the practicability of the product is greatly promoted.

Background technology
Along with widely using of air-conditioning, the indoor environmental pollution caused because of air-conditioning more and more be familiar with by people, various antibacterial, yeast and mold multiply without restraint in places such as A/C evaporator, filter screen, air channels, part population is long-time, and easily initiation is uncomfortable in this environment, therefore, for the microorganism of air-conditioning inside to kill technical research extremely urgent.
At present, the technology that can realize air-conditioning sterilizing has silver ion net, anion, light hydrogen plasma etc.But often there are some drawbacks in above-mentioned sterilization method.Wherein, the netted bactericidal unit being representative with silver ion net, effect is generally undesirable, and after using a period of time, after the pollutant such as silver ion net surface adhesive dust, effect is more not obvious, and for air-conditioning, also increases windage; For negative ion sterilizing technology, then need high-pressure generating circuit, and its bactericidal effect is for simply very little under the environment of dynamic air current.

Detailed description of the invention
Should be appreciated that specific embodiment described herein only in order to explain the present invention, be not intended to limit the present invention.
As shown in Figure 1 to Figure 3, present pre-ferred embodiments proposes a kind of electrolysis sterilization device, comprising: electrolysis bath 1, water jet 2 and actuating unit, wherein:
Electrolysis bath 1 for store and the liquid such as brine electrolysis to produce strong oxidizer;
Actuating unit, is connected between described electrolysis bath 1 and described water jet 2, for the electrolyte after electrolysis bath 1 electrolysis is delivered to described water jet 2; As a kind of embodiment, this actuating unit specifically can adopt water pump 22.
Water jet 2 for actuating unit is transmitted, electrolyte after electrolysis bath 1 electrolysis sprays to external equipment, in order to sterilize to described external equipment.This water jet 2 realizes automatic spray by electrical control.
Particularly, in the present embodiment, described electrolysis bath 1 comprises: water tank 12 and the electrode 11 be arranged in water tank 12.
Wherein, described electrode 11 is sheet metal.Described electrode 11 is provided with positive pole (anode, represent with "+" in Fig. 1) and negative pole (negative electrode, represent with "-" in Fig. 1), the two poles of the earth pass to unidirectional current, then can carry out electrolysis to the solution in water tank 12, such as electrolysis is carried out to tap water, the composition that hypochlorous acid, chloric acid, hydrogen peroxide, ground state oxygen etc. have strong oxidizing property can be produced in the electrolytic solution, to microorganisms such as antibacterial, mycete, yeast, there is stronger killing effect.
As a kind of embodiment, the spacing between the positive pole of electrode 11, negative pole can be set to 0.5mm ~ 10mm.
In addition, the regional area of electrode 11 or Zone Full can be provided with the mesh 111 that electrolysis solution passes through.
In the present embodiment, electrode 11 comprises base material 112, and described base material 112 is titanium metal material; The surface of described base material 112 is provided with coating 113, and as shown in Figure 3, described coating 113 material can mix for one or more in the elements such as platinum, ruthenium, iridium.It has excellent corrosion resistance and chemical stability, and electrode 11 material itself can not participate in electrolytic process.
The top of the present embodiment water tank 12 is provided with water inlet 121, and bottom is provided with outlet 123, and described outlet 123 is connected with the input of described actuating unit (the present embodiment is illustrated with water pump 22).
The bottom of described water tank 12 or bottom are provided with the first water level switch 13 for detecting low water level in water tank 12, the top of described water tank 12 is provided with the second water level switch 14 for detecting high water level in water tank 12, by the second water level switch 14, whether the water level that can detect in water tank 12 exceedes early warning value; Described water inlet 121 is also connected with electromagnetic valve 122, in order to control the ON/OFF of water inlet 121.
By above-mentioned water inlet 121, second water level switch 14 and electromagnetic valve 122 cooperatively interact realize water be automatically injected, detect and control open/stop function.Specifically, water inlet 121 can be connected with running water pipe, and water enters water tank 12 automatically, and after water level reaches requirement, the second water level switch 14 action feeds back to controller Controlling solenoid valve 122 and closes, and stops water filling.
Coordinated by above-mentioned outlet 123, first water level switch 13, the automatic control that water tank 12 lowest water level and water pump 22 are opened/stop can be realized.In brief, when water level is lower than warning line, controller can be stopped transport water pump 22, in order to avoid unloaded.
As a kind of embodiment, above-mentioned first water level switch 13 and the second water level switch 14 are specifically as follows dry-reed tube switch.
In addition, the present embodiment is also provided with air vent 124 at water tank 12 top.Due in electrolytic process, the height of voltage is different, having air release, for preventing water tank 12 internal pressure kept from increasing, carrying out venting pressure release by air vent 124, to guarantee electrolysis sterilization device use safety at the anode of electrode 11, negative electrode.
In the present embodiment, water jet 2 comprises shower nozzle 21 and connects the water pipe 23 of shower nozzle 21 and water pump 22.Described shower nozzle 21 bottom even offers some water draining beaks 211, and the top of described water draining beak 211 exceeds 1 ~ 5mm bottom described shower nozzle 21.Electrolysis water pump 22 can be delivered to inside shower nozzle 21, then evenly overflow through water draining beak 211, clean external equipment, sterilizes after starting by water pump 22.
As a kind of embodiment, the present embodiment electrolysis sterilization device can be applied in air-conditioner evaporator, filter screen or water purifier, when brine electrolysis is sprinkled upon after on A/C evaporator, filter screen or clearing machine, electrolyte is to microbial actions such as antibacterials and kill, physics cleaning is carried out to above-mentioned effective object simultaneously, realize clean, sterilization thus, comprehensive function that humidification is integrated, the practicality of improving product greatly.
As can be seen from the above scheme, the present embodiment electrolysis sterilization device can realize automatic plumbing on the one hand, cleans special object; In addition, this device also can carry out electrolysis to tap water etc. and produce strong oxidizer, the object that need clean is carried out to the microorganisms such as antibacterial, mycete, yeast and efficiently kills, and have suffered process environmental protection; In addition, be equipped with the air-conditioner of this device, clearing machine etc. and can realize sterilized humidifying function.
In addition, as shown in Figure 4, the embodiment of the present invention also proposes a kind of control method of brine electrolysis bactericidal unit of above-described embodiment, and the method specifically comprises:
Step S101, starts purification and sterilization function;
Step S102, injects by electrolyte in the water tank of electrolysis bath;
Step S103, to the electrifying electrodes in electrolysis bath water tank, to being carried out electrolysis by electrolyte in water tank, runs according to the setting working time;
Step S104, after electrolysis completes, starts actuating unit, the electrolyte in water tank is transferred to water jet;
Step S105, the electrolyte that water jet receives the transmission of described actuating unit sterilizes to external equipment.
Wherein, to water filling in water tank etc. by the process of electrolyte, in order to whether the water level detected in water tank exceedes early warning value, while injecting by electrolyte in the water tank of electrolysis bath, also need to monitor high water level in water tank, and Controlling solenoid valve switch motion; Especially by water inlet, the second water level switch and electromagnetic valve cooperatively interact realize water be automatically injected, detect and control open/stop function.Specifically, water inlet can be connected with running water pipe, and water enters water tank automatically, and after water level reaches requirement, the second water level switch action feeds back to controller Controlling solenoid valve and closes, and stops water filling.
In addition, also need to monitor the low water level of water tank while startup actuating unit, output signal the foundation opening as actuating unit/stop.Coordinate especially by outlet, the first water level switch, the automatic control that water tank lowest water level and water pump are opened/stop can be realized.In brief, when water level is lower than warning line, controller can be stopped transport water pump, in order to avoid unloaded.
As shown in Figure 5, as a kind of embody rule example, for electrolysis tap water, the control flow of the present embodiment electrolysis sterilization device is as follows:
S0: start purification and sterilization function;
S1: water tank with water, water level monitoring, monitors water tank high water level simultaneously, and Controlling solenoid valve switch motion;
S2: start electrolysis installation, ran according to the setting working time;
S3: electrolysis completes;
S4: start water pump pump water, water level monitoring, monitors water tank low water level, output signal the foundation opening as water pump/stop simultaneously.
S5: sterilization.
Embodiment of the present invention electrolysis sterilization device and control method thereof, only need carry out low-voltage electrolysis to solution such as ordinary tap water, its electrolyte can reach more than 99.9% to the killing effect of the microorganism such as antibacterial, mycete, and whole process safety is reliable, without the need to using toxic and harmful substance, the comprehensive function that it can realize clean, sterilization to the equipment such as A/C evaporator, filter screen or clearing machine, humidification is integrated, the practicality of improving product greatly.
